Oakland Radiers head coach Dennis Allen took some time on Friday to join 'The Wheelhouse' on 95.7 The Game in San Francisco to discuss how training camp has been going thus far, having some exemplary things to say about linebacker Rolando McClain.
Rolando McClain Has Been ‘Exceptional’ At Raiders Training Camp
When asked whom he’s been impressed with the most in camp, Allen was quick to mention McClain and the hard work he’s been putting in:
A guy I think that has been exceptional has been Rolando McClain. He’s been a guy that has done everything we have asked him to do. He’s smart. He understands the defense and the concepts we are trying to run and if he continues to improve the way he has been improving and continues to fit within the scheme the way he has done so far I would expect him to have a good year.
McClain is still dealing with some off the field issues, but has seemingly figured it out on the field so far in camp. He recorded 99 tackles and five sacks for Oakland last season.
